In Match No. 32, West Delhi Lions (WDL) and Purani Dilli 6 (PD) are going to clash at the Arun Jaitley Stadium, New Delhi, on Saturday, August 23, at 7:00 PM IST. The Lions are riding high at the moment. They are currently placed third on the points table with a two-match winning streak and have managed to clinch eight points from seven outings. Purani Dilli 6 has found it hard to win this season and has only managed to come out victorious twice in their seven matches. They are currently at the bottom of the points table and are eager to get out of there.
The WDL team will not want to lose their upbeat momentum and get a vital victory that will increase their chances of the playoffs, while PD will be aiming to make good their losses and obtain a positive mindset with a victory from this game.
WDL vs PD: Head-to-Head
Purani Dilli 6 and West Delhi Lions have played three times against each other. PD won all three encounters.
WDL vs PD: Pitch Report
The Arun Jaitley Stadium is the batter's paradise, with the small boundaries giving it a batter-friendly venue. Batters normally have a field day, but bowlers will have to be on their game, especially in the last few overs. Teams that win the toss are more likely to opt to bat first to set a tough total.
